#A68BDA Hex Color Code

#A68BDA

The Hexadecimal Color #A68BDA is a contrast shade of Medium Purple. #A68BDA RGB value is rgb(166, 139, 218). RGB Color Model of #A68BDA consists of 65% red, 54% green and 85% blue. HSL color Mode of #A68BDA has 261°(degrees) Hue, 52% Saturation and 70% Lightness. #A68BDA color has an wavelength of 455.66667n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#A68BDA is #CC99F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#A68BDA is #A8D. The Closest Color to #A68BDA is #9370DB. Official Name of #A68BDA Hex Code is East Side.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#A68BDA is 24 Cyan 36 Magenta 0 Yellow 15 Black and #A68BDA CMY is 24, 36,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#A68BDA is hsl(261,52,70,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(261, 36,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#A68BDA is 37.61, 31.63, 70.44.
Hex8 Value of #A68BDA is #A68BDAFF. Decimal Value of #A68BDA is 10914778 and Octal Value of #A68BDA is 51505732. Binary Value of #A68BDA is 10100110, 10001011, 11011010 and Android of #A68BDA is 4289104858 / 0xffa68bda.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#A68BDA is 0.269, 0.226, 0.226 and YIQ Color Space of #A68BDA is 156.079, -9.2934, 30.2953.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#A68BDA is 29.71, 27.66, 69.81.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#A68BDA is 63.04, 26.41, -36.71.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#A68BDA is 63.04, 8.3, -61.32.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#A68BDA is 63.04, 45.22, 305.73. Hunter Lab variable of #A68BDA is 56.24, 20.95, -34.89.

Various Color Shades of #A68BDA

To get 25% Saturated #A68BDA Color, you need to convert the hex color #A68BDA to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#A68BDA h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#A68BDA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
